TEMPO.CO, Jakarta - The Indonesian National Police Chief Listyo Sigit Prabowo in an internal video conference on Thursday said that the handling of the alleged premeditated murder case incriminating the former Internal Affairs chief Ferdy Sambo helped build a positive image of the police institution. The case is handled under a special team formed by the police chief.
In the initial wake of the incident, the public perception of the police institution dwindled as questions of a cover-up emerged. He asserted that the special team led by police deputy chief commissioner general Gatot Eddy Pramono will remain transparent in solving this case that captured the public’s attention.
"Of course, there are still some activities that we are currently carrying out related to the case, and this is a gamble for the National Police institution, a gamble on the dignity of the Police," said Listyo Sigit in a video conference to his entire staff on August 19.
“Nothing will be covered up and we will reveal everything factually and the truth. This is what we are holding onto,” Sigit asserted.
The police were under the spotlight when the initial case of Brigadier J's murder surfaced - who is Ferdy Sambo’s personal aide. The reason is that many people consider the initial police version of the story did not add up, which eventually turned out to be a false narrative from Sambo.
